Gifted with synesthesia - the ability to see sounds as colors and affording her perfect pitch - Allissa was a brilliant violinist attending the prestigious Basile Academy for Musical Arts. She had her whole life planned. Become a Master violinist. Marry her best friend Michael. Tour the world filling it with sound and color. It was a simple and beautiful plan. And then Michael was murdered. Allissa's world became colorless. Attending his funeral gave no peace, only questions. There are no clues. No motives. Just his body, cut to ribbons, and strange drawings in his bedroom of eyes and a face no one recognized. Among his belongings were notes about the founder of Basile Academy, Nathaniel Basile, and the curiosities around the founder's synesthesia. Plagued with grief and questions, Allissa's world shifts. She sees smells, hears colors, and living music notes dance before her eyes. A world only she can see but that eerily resembles what Nathaniel Basile experienced. But among the beauty and wonder are broken notes, patches of emptiness, and Discord. Allissa can't explain any of it and her problems begin to mount when her new abilities turn into something physical. She can shape the world through her music, bend it to her will. And Discord doesn't like it. Now an unseen emptiness is stalking her. A physical emptiness that wants her to be silent. Unless Allissa can master her new abilities, her fate may be the same as Michael's, possibly worse.
